Early Development of Japanese Naval Air Power

The Society for Nautical Research’s (SNR) journal ‘ Mariner’s Mirror’ (vol 99:3, August 2013, 312-322) has an excellent article,by Jonathan Parkinson, on the above subject

It traces the conversion of a British merchant vessel, captured in the Russo-Japanese war as a prize, to the seaplane tender Wakamiya Maru. It also details the Japanese use of Naval aircraft in the operations against the German territory in Shandong; the attachment of IJN officers to the RN on Furious, Argus and Campania and the secondment of British personnel to the IJN post war.
